**Ticket: Config drift on BounceSift processor**

The email bounce processor in the Larkfield environment has drifted from the values committed in the release branch. Retry windows and suppression thresholds no longer match, which likely explains the duplicate suppression entries reported Tuesday. Please reconcile before the Thursday cut. For reference, the currently deployed configuration on the live node reads as follows.

config for yajep-yahof:
[briax]
port = 9200
region = outer-2
host = briax.nelvrocorp.test
team = raleth
timeout_ms = 1500
retries = 1

Handover: GateTally counter at Varsten Arena. Resolved the double-count bug on turnstile bank C — debounce window was too short. Counts now reconcile within 0.2% of manual tallies. Left the reconciliation cron at hourly; don't change before the Kolvik derby. Remaining: lane 7 sensor still flaky, ticket filed. Deploy went out Tuesday, no rollback needed. The current service configuration is as follows.

deployment values, yahag-tawef:
ZORWYN_HOST=zorwyn.tolvaqlabs.internal
ZORWYN_PORT=9300

**Vendor note: Inkmill markdown pipeline**

Rendering for Parchway docs is outsourced to Inkmill under an annual contract, renewing each March. They handle sanitization and PDF export; we own the upload queue. SLA: 4-hour response on rendering failures. Escalate only after two failed retries. Their support desk is reachable at the address below.

billing contact of hahaf-baguf = zorael.tammir.jorius@sivrelhq.internal

## Build Provenance: Telemetry Compression

Since the Larkspur 4.2 rollout, all telemetry payloads from the Quillbeam agents are zstd-compressed before signing. Provenance attestation happens post-compression, so checksums reflect the compressed blob. If an on-call alert fires on digest mismatch, verify against the token from the originating build below.

session token of taduf-tahog = htk4_91a1